Output 14395b08e109c1a677317866e6aad91eaecd7b2fb23099ca0e31b9254e6a0cb1:7

value
49842459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c8d4c377a4ad170f712a3f24b294fc268a9448 OP_EQUAL
address
MJuouSTpbA5PQNC3DiqUUkfmzNqMpbHkEa
transaction
14395b08e109c1a677317866e6aad91eaecd7b2fb23099ca0e31b9254e6a0cb1
spent
true